New Renault Duster India debut on January 26, 2026
Renault India has officially confirmed that the all-new Duster will make its India debut on January 26, 2026, marking the long-awaited return of one of its most popular products in the country. The new Duster will arrive almost five years after production of the previous Duster for India ended in 2022.
